South Country Central School District Snapshot
Location: East Patchogue, NY
School District: South Country Central School District
Grades Served: PK-12
Technology Environment: The district utilizes Google Apps for Education for student and staff productivity and Office 365 for staff email access. It is transitioning to Parent Square for all communications starting with the 2025-2026 school year. A significant network infrastructure upgrade for switches and wireless access points is underway.
Key Initiative: Enhancing digital communication and upgrading core network infrastructure.

1. Network Infrastructure Upgrade
What South Country Central School District Is Doing
South Country Central School District is upgrading its network switches and wireless infrastructure across all district locations. This project aims to replace current network switches and wireless access points, with completion scheduled for June 30, 2026. The district seeks solutions that integrate with the existing network environment and support future bandwidth needs.

2. Unified Communication Platform Implementation
What South Country Central School District Is Doing
South Country Central School District is transitioning to Parent Square as its unified communication platform for all district communications, beginning with the 2025-2026 school year. This initiative centralizes communication channels for families and staff.
